The Social Science Scholars Program was created in 2011 to recognize and challenge outstanding majors in the College of Social Sciences and Public Policy. Social Science Scholars are chosen through a highly competitive process. Those selected participate in a leadership seminar during the spring semester of their junior year. The seminar prepares students for internships as well as for research and service projects that are undertaken during the following summer semester.
Social Science Scholars receive funding up to $5,000 for approved travel and other expenses related to their internships or projects. The latter may be conducted in the U.S. or abroad. The following fall, the scholars report on their leadership projects, attend seminars and symposia, and work with mentors to prepare for graduate school, as well as other postgraduate opportunities.
Applicants for the 2025 Social Science Scholars Program must have completed their liberal studies requirements and been accepted as a major in the College of Social Sciences and Public Policy. They must also have a cumulative GPA of 3.3 or higher. Engagements in service, research and work activities, both on or off campus, are weighted heavily in the selection process.
